Dimensions and Abilities
Although built-in kitchens vary in size, these ovens usually have a width of 45 to 90 cm. The most typical sizes are:
- Single Built-in Oven. For small families or those with a tiny kitchen, this 60 cm single oven is perfect.
- Double Built-in Oven. This 90-cm double oven is ideal for large families or people who enjoy cooking many meals at once.
- Compact Oven. Compact built-in ovens (45 cm) are excellent as a backup oven or in little kitchens.
To make sure it can accommodate your culinary demands, consider the internal capacity, which is measured in litres.

- Option for Self-Cleaning
Oven cleaning can be time-consuming; however, self-cleaning models make it simpler. By heating the oven to high degrees, pyrolytic cleaning converts food residue and oil into ash that is readily removed. Catalytic cleaning is another great option. It cleans your kitchen area by absorbing grease, special liners simplify manual cleaning.
- Efficiency of Energy
An energy-efficient oven is both ecologically beneficial and helps save power costs. To guarantee efficiency without compromising on performance, look for built-in oven models with an energy rating of A+ or better.

Type of Oven Door
- Usability and space efficiency may be affected by the kind of oven door. So, when you invest in a built-in oven, make sure to check:
- The most popular style is the drop-down door in built-in ovens, which opens downward like a standard oven.
- Built-in ovens with side-opening doors make accessing a built-in wall oven easier.
- Another oven door style for easier access is the Slide & Hide Door, whichpulls back beneath the built-in oven compartment.

Safety Features
- Particularly in homes with children, safety is vital, and built-in ovens with their new safety features make it easy. Keep an eye out for these safeguards:
- Safetylock that prevents unintentional use.
- Cool-touch doors to ensure that even in extremely hot conditions, the outside is safe to touch.
